MUMBAI, India, July 24 -- Intellectual Property India has published a patent application (202641084765 A) filed by Mohan Babu University on July 10, 2026, for Fire-Resistant Hybrid Composite Electrical Conduit Pipe Reinforced With Natural Fibers And Sugarcane Biochar.
Inventors include Dr. G. Velmurugan; Mr. V. Anil Kumar; and Mr. S. Lokesh Sai.
The application for the patent was published on July 17, 2026, under issue no. 29/2026.
Abstract: The present invention relates to a fire-resistant hybrid composite electrical conduit pipe reinforced with flax fibers, kenaf fibers, and sugarcane biochar as a sustainable alternative to conventional polyvinyl chloride (PVC) conduit pipes. The conduit pipe comprises an epoxy matrix reinforced with a Flax/Kenaf/Flax fiber arrangement and sugarcane biochar incorporated as a multifunctional reinforcing and fire-retardant filler. An optimized biochar loading of 4.5 wt.% provides improved mechanical and fire-retardant properties, exhibiting a tensile strength of 38.01 MPa, flexural strength of 76.12 MPa, impact strength of 9.62 kJ/m², and hardness of 86 Shore D. The composite further exhibits a Limiting Oxygen Index (LOI) of 28.4% and a reduced Peak Heat Release Rate (PHRR) of approximately 300 kW/m², demonstrating enhanced fire resistance through the formation of a stable carbonaceous char layer. The invention provides a lightweight, durable, environmentally friendly, and fire-resistant electrical conduit pipe suitable for residential, commercial, and industrial applications.
